El número primo es aquel que solo es divisible por 1 y por sí mismo, sin dejar residuo. En este artículo, aprenderás cómo crear un fluxograma para determinar si un número es primo o no. El fluxograma es una herramienta visual que te ayudará a comprender y seguir los pasos para verificar la primariedad de un número.
¿Qué es un fluxograma?
Antes de entrar en los detalles de cómo crear un fluxograma para determinar si un número es primo, es importante entender qué es un fluxograma. En términos simples, un fluxograma es una representación gráfica de un proceso o algoritmo. Utiliza símbolos y diagramas para mostrar los diferentes pasos y decisiones a tomar en el proceso.
Pasos para crear el fluxograma
1. Inicio: Comienza por poner un óvalo que represente el punto de inicio del proceso.
2. Ingresar el número: Coloca un rectángulo que simbolice la entrada del número que deseas verificar si es primo o no.
3. División entre 2: Añade una decisión en forma de rombo para comprobar si el número es divisible entre 2.
4. División entre 3: Si el número no es divisible entre 2, añade otra decisión para verificar si es divisible entre 3.
5. División entre los números siguientes: Continúa añadiendo decisiones para comprobar la divisibilidad entre los números siguientes, incrementándolos de forma secuencial.
6. Último número: Llegará un punto en el que te encuentres comprobando la divisibilidad entre un número n. Añade otra decisión para verificar si el número es divisible entre n.
7. Resultado: Si el número es divisible entre alguno de los números anteriores, coloca una flecha que te lleve al resultado “No es primo”. De lo contrario, coloca una flecha que te lleve al resultado “Es primo”. Esta es la salida del fluxograma.
Importancia de cada paso
A lo largo del fluxograma, es crucial realizar las comprobaciones en el orden adecuado. Comenzar verificando la divisibilidad entre 2 y 3 es eficiente, ya que la mayoría de los números no son divisibles por 2 ni por 3. Luego, continuar comprobando la divisibilidad entre los números siguientes asegura una mayor eficiencia en el proceso.
El último número a verificar es n, donde n es la raíz cuadrada del número que se está evaluando. Esto se debe a que no es necesario comprobar números mayores que la raíz cuadrada, ya que cualquier divisor más grande tendría un divisor más pequeño correspondiente.
Uso de símbolos adecuados
Es importante utilizar los símbolos adecuados en el fluxograma para representar las diferentes acciones y decisiones. Por ejemplo, utilizar rombos para las decisiones (como la divisibilidad entre 2 o 3) y rectángulos para las acciones (como la entrada del número o el resultado final). Esto garantiza que el fluxograma sea fácil de entender y seguir.
Optimización y eficiencia
Para un mejor rendimiento y eficiencia, se pueden aplicar optimizaciones a este fluxograma. Por ejemplo, en lugar de comprobar la divisibilidad entre todos los números siguientes, se puede realizar un salto y comprobar solo los números primos hasta la raíz cuadrada del número que se está evaluando. Esto ahorra pasos y mejora el rendimiento del fluxograma.
Aplicaciones prácticas
Este fluxograma puede utilizarse en una variedad de situaciones en las que se necesite verificar si un número es primo. Por ejemplo, puede ser útil en algoritmos de encriptación, análisis de datos o incluso en juegos matemáticos.
Preguntas frecuentes
P: ¿Puedo utilizar este fluxograma en cualquier lenguaje de programación?
R: Sí, puedes implementar este fluxograma en cualquier lenguaje de programación. Solo debes adaptar los símbolos y la sintaxis de acuerdo al lenguaje que estés utilizando.
P: ¿Cuáles son los primeros números primos?
R: Los primeros números primos son 2, 3, 5, 7, 11, 13, y así sucesivamente. Estos números solo son divisibles por 1 y por sí mismos.
P: ¿Puedo determinar si un número es primo sin utilizar un fluxograma?
R: Sí, existen diferentes algoritmos y técnicas para determinar si un número es primo sin necesidad de utilizar un fluxograma. Sin embargo, el fluxograma proporciona una manera visual de entender y seguir el proceso paso a paso.
P: ¿Cuál es la importancia de verificar la primariedad de un número?
R: Verificar si un número es primo o no es importante en varios campos, como la criptografía y la seguridad informática. Los números primos juegan un papel clave en el desarrollo de algoritmos y sistemas seguros.
En conclusión, la creación de un fluxograma para determinar si un número es primo es un proceso importante que puede ayudarte a comprender y seguir el proceso paso a paso. Este fluxograma puede ser utilizado en diferentes situaciones y es una herramienta útil para verificar la primariedad de un número. Espero que este artículo te haya brindado una comprensión clara de cómo crear y utilizar un fluxograma para números primos.